Recent progress of the 20-channel grating polychromator on EAST

    https://doi.org/10.1142/9789814340274_0032Cited by:0 (Source: Crossref)
    Abstract:

    A 20-channel grating polychromator transferred from PPPL, has been re-built for electron cyclotron emission measurements on EAST. This instrument measures the second harmonic electron cyclotron emission from plasma with frequency range from 90 GHz to 250 GHz, which corresponds to a central magnetic field (R0=1.7 m) of 2-3.5 T. The radial resolution is around 2.5 cm. New pre-amplifiers are made and tested, based on the electronics of GPC-II on TFTR. These amplifiers have a gain of around 520, with a 400 kHz 3 dB roll off frequency.
